/* CSS Document */
/* menu.css dt (menu princ) dd (sous menu) */
dl, dt, dd, ul, li {
	margin: 0;
	padding: 0;
	list-style-type: none;
}
#menu1 {
margin-top: 5px;
margin-left: 259px;
width: 100px;
font-size: small;
}
#menu2 {
margin-top: -22px;
margin-left: 359px;
width: 100px;
font-size: small;
}
#menu3 {
margin-top: -22px;
margin-left: 459px;
width: 220px;
font-size: small;
}
#menu4 {
margin-top: -22px;
margin-left: 679px;
width: 60px;
font-size: small;
}
#menu1 dt, #menu2 dt, #menu3 dt, #menu4 dt {
cursor: pointer;
background: url(../images/barremenu1.gif);
height: 20px;
line-height: 20px;
margin: 1px 1px;
text-align: center;
font-weight: bold;
}

#menu1 dd, #menu2 dd, #menu3 dd, #menu4 dd {
	position: absolute;
	z-index: 100;
	margin-left: -90px;
	margin-top: 8px;
	width: 530px;
	/*background: url(../images/barremenu4.gif);*/
	height: 21px;
	font-weight: bold;
}
#menu1 ul, #menu2 ul, #menu3 ul, #menu4 ul {
padding: 0px;
}
#menu1 li, #menu2 li, #menu3 li, #menu4 li {
text-align: center;
font-size: 100%;
height: 21px;
line-height: 21px;
display: inline;
}
#menu1 dt a, #menu2 dt a, #menu3 dt a, #menu4 dt a {
color: #525252;
text-decoration: none;
display: block;
}
#menu1 li a, #menu2 li a, #menu3 li a, #menu4 li a {
text-align: center;
color: #525252;
text-decoration: none;
display: inline;
}
#menu1 dd a:hover, #menu2 dd a:hover, #menu3 dd a:hover, #menu4 dd a:hover {
	/*background: url(../images/barremenu3.gif);*/
	font-weight: bold;
	color: #FFFFFF;
}
#menu1 dt a:hover, #menu2 dt a:hover, #menu3 dt a:hover, #menu4 dt a:hover {
	background: url(../images/barremenu2.gif);
	color: #525252;
}
